
Nestled among canopies of mesquite along the desert foothills of Mingus Mountain in Clarkdale, Ariz., the Yavapai College Verde Valley Campus is cultivating a bright and sustainable future for Northern Arizona’s emerging grape and wine industry.
Surrounded by 80 acres of undeveloped, available land the campus’ high desert setting is judged by viticulture experts as an ideal location for wine and table grape vineyards.
The vision for a future Viticulture and Enology program took root following several brainstorming Charrettes hosted by the college. After reviewing the costs, benefits, and job creation potential of the region’s wine and grape industry with community members, business professionals, educational partners, and special interest groups such as the Verde Valley Wine Consortium a vision was launched and Yavapai College’s Verde Valley Vineyards project was born.
Yavapai College has educated Yavapai County residents in the areas of general education, arts, business, agriculture, lifelong learning and community education for more than 40 years. The North Central Association of Colleges and Schools Commission on Institutions of Higher Education (NCACHE) accredit Yavapai College. The college’s agriculture and science programs are ranked in the top 10 for community colleges nationally.
